Having Constant Headache, Pain In The Breast And Weight Gain. Not Pregnant. What Else Could Be The Reason?

Hi I ve been feeling very sick for a past few days along with constant headache and pain in my breast as well as gaining lot of weight for past 4 weeks although my eating habits haven t changed .... I did a pregnancy test today thinking maybe I m pregnant although my period has been normal so what could these symptoms be for?

I think that your symptoms could be related to thyroid problem. You need to check your thyroid, blood sugar and blood pressure. Further, you can consult a local doctor who can help you through a clinical examination so that he will perform focused investigations to diagnose your problem and guide you the accurate management.

I suggest you to stay relaxed and get evaluated as I have discussed.
